Fluorescence Spectral Studies on the Coordination of Calix[4]arenes Bearing Boronic Acid Moieties with Amino Acids

Abstract: Coordination of ten kinds of calix[4]arenes bearing boronic acid moieties with four kinds of amino acids was studied by using fluorescence spectrometry. The stability constants( Ks) of the complexes of calix[4]arenes bearing boronic acid moieties with amino acids and Gibbs free energy change(-Δ G °) of the coordination reactions were calculated according to the modified Hilderbrand Benesi equation. The results obtained indicated that the coordination abilities and selectivities of Lalanine with calix[4]arenes bearing boronic acid moieties were stronger than that of the other amino acids, and that the above calix[4]arene derivatives could be used for identification of D-alanine.
